Martin Fox and Sharon Howe, the coordinators for Exeter Friends For Animals, share with me their reasons for becoming and remaining vegans.
Some would say non-vegans do not often listen to vegans' views. Equally, vegans do not always adequately respond to non-vegans' challenges. This conversation gave space for both of these hang ups to be set aside.
It also reveals answers to questions many vegans are never asked. Besides highlighting the personal and global impacts of a common diet in contrast to a vegan one.
